    The First International Conference on Signal and Information Processing, Networking and Computers (ICSINC) focuses on the key technologies and challenges of signal and information processing schemes, network application, computer theory and application, etc. Topics in this conference include:
    Information Theory
    The work contains state-of-the-art research work in the field of information theory from traditional media coding theory, compressing and streaming theory to the latest quantum theory & statistics and big data analytics, featuring the most active research interests in this field.
    Communication System
    As a traditional and fundamental aspect of the conference in the field of signal processing and networking, ICSINC publications includes research works focusing on physical layer transmission theory such as MIMO transmission, adaptive antenna theory, and radar and satellite transmission, etc. Research works in the field of SDN, wireless security and 5G related theories are also included.
    Computer Science
    The conference also encompasses relevant topics in computer science such as AI & neural network, patter recognition & learning, and medical image processing etc. Other topics such as internet application, biometric & authentication are also included.
    Workshop
    ICSINC features workshops hosted by experts from the industrial world. The workshop on Telecom Big Data based Research and Application promotes the in-depth exploration of the most recent research and development findings on the basis of telecom big data. This workshop provides participation of the industry to showcase and commercialize their relevant technology and application as well as products. All materials will be included in publication.

    Biography

    Na Chen received her B.Sc. degree in 2011 from Beijing University of Posts and Telecommunications, China. She is currently a Ph.D. candidate at Beijing University of Posts and Telecommunications. Her research interest includes signal processing, wireless communications, multimedia communication. Her current work focuses on the resource constrained wireless multimedia transmission. Tingting Huang received her B.S. Degree in Electronic Information Science?and Technology?in 2014?from the College of Physical Science and Technology,?Central China Normal University, China. Since September 2014, she has been working and studying at the Multimedia Communications and Interactive Institute, Beijing University of Posts and Telecommunications, China. Her research interests include High Efficiency Video Coding (HEVC), Joint Source Channel Coding (JSCC) and Machine Learning.?
